I just made a lightweight sling design based on the seat belt sling. It has a leather pouch and holds golf balls. Would anyone be interested in one for free? I like making them and want someone to try them out. They are kinda "futuristic" to me because the ends are whipped in fishing line and then cotton thread. They may not be pretty, but I doubt one will ever break throwing golf balls. I tend to focus on functionality.  



 
This is version one. Notice the whipped ends are tied together, that won't be there on the next one. I have tried them out, and I like that they can easily slip into your pocket and are very strong.

Nice whipping job.  You know what I would do? I would pull one strand of the innards out of that paracord, do west country whipping with it and then coat it with super glue.  Your work is really clean, keep it up.
